My Review

Sometimes life takes a turn that we aren't expecting. Discouragement can set in, even despair. But God uses all things to refine his children, making us into who we need to be.

Former Green Beret Heath Daniels and his Military War Dog, Trinity, are an inseparable team. After a career ending injury, Heath and Trinity become members of A Breed Apart, a unique program to boost morale for active military personnel. Their first assignment finds them in Afghanistan where they meet Darci Kintz. 

Darci is illusive and careful to keep herself distanced from relationships due to her job but there's an instant connection between her and Heath. When she goes missing, Heath and Trinity are asked to join the Special Forces Team that's going into enemy controlled territory to find her and bring her back. 

There's just no disappointment when I read book written by Ronie Kendig. Action. Faith. Suspense. Romance. It's all there, expertly written and woven together to keep me focused on one thing only...the story. 

I love how my whole being felt suspended while reading this book. I was full of anticipation, anxiety, and joy; on pins and needles to see what was coming next. If even a fraction of what is written in this book could possibly be true concerning the MWD and handler relationship, then I have to say BRAVO to our military for cultivating some of the finest soldiers out there! And certainly a huge shout out to the author for educating me on such an important aspect of our military, creating fascinating scenarios that unequivocally make my heart pound and my soul weep for the dangers our men and women volunteer to put themselves in, all so I can have the privilege of being an American citizen!

I highly recommend this book to any lover of suspense, actually to anyone because if you're not a fan of high level military suspense now, you just may be after reading Trinity: Military War Dog. I'm looking forward to all the books in this exciting new series!
